Mclaren
Mar 12 2009
Last Sunday morning a dog appeared at the property next door to where I work. The next day the resident of the house brought him over to me to see if we could find his owner. I went on the website for Nashville Humane Society, where I saw the link to Nashville Pet Finders. I found his picture on the Nashville Pet Finders website and tried to contact the owners, but there was one too many numbers in her phone number. I called Nashville Humane Society again and they gave me the owner’s correct number. In about 20 minutes Mclaren’s owner was there to pick him up. Mclaren’s owner asked the owner of A&F Electric what the A stood for in A&F. He told her Atwood. Turns out that is the name of Mclaren’s owner. After looking through some family records I found out they are related. Happy story all the way around!

Our Three Beautiful Girls
Jan 27 2009
Thanks to Nashville Petfinders we were able to get our three beautiful German Shepards back. They had gotten out of the fence (chasing another animal; cat, squirrel, rat ???) but couldnt get back in the way they came out. We could tell they tried by the way the fence was. We checked everywhere. We thought for sure that animal control had them. They didn’t have their collars on so our hopes of ever finding them were very grim.
After a couple of days I was on the Internet looking at found dogs and I decided to post them on the Nashville Petfinders website, as well as a few others. I didn’t even have pictures of them, but somehow by the grace of God they were found. They had only been listed a few days and I got the calls and the e-mails. I was so excited.
A very nice family had been keeping them after they showed up at their house (only 1 day after they got out). They had just about given up on anyone claiming them so they had called animal control. The man from animal control came out saw the dogs and before he took them he checked with the Nashville Petfinders database and then we got the call. I know without Nashville Petfinders we wouldn’t have found them, and without their collars, no one would have known how to find us.
So, my family and I are very grateful and I will make sure I tell everyone I know about you and the great service you are to Nashville. God Bless Nashville Petfinders.org!
